Set in a historic building in central Cape Town, Three Boutique Hotel features a 7-yard designer tiled pool with underwater lighting. Its rooftop sundeck offers panoramic views of Table Mountain, Devil’s Peak, Lions Head and Signal Hill. Wall-mounted flat-screen TVs and free Wi-Fi are featured in Three Boutique Hotel's modern and elegant rooms. Frameless rain showers and modern sinks can be found in the bathrooms. The poolside granite deck offers a fresh spot to enjoy the South African sun or relax in the shade of the gazebo with a good book. Guests can enjoy a coffee in the stylish lounge or in the shade of the central courtyard. Cape Town International Airport is around 11 mi away, and Three Boutique Hotel provides an airport shuttle for an additional fee. There is secure, onsite parking for 12 cars.

Property info

This residence, originally named “Schoonder Sigt” (“Clear View”), is deeply steeped in the history of South Africa. In the 1770s it was one of the ten most conspicuous large manors of Cape Town. It was owned and occupied by the Commandant of the Castle, General Robert J. Gordon, who discovered and mapped a good part of South Africa. He discovered and also named our great river, the Orange (after the Prince of Orange), and Plettenberg Bay (after Governor Von Plettenberg). Gordon’s Bay was named after him.

Neighborhood info

Oranjezicht is a stylish little village, popular with the arty and trendy set, lying in the foothills of Table Mountain. From afar, homes here appear to lie relatively low on the mountain, but driving through the suburb, one quickly adjusts one’s perception - it’s quite a climb to reach parts of upmarket Oranjezicht in Cape Town, but well worth it. Oranjezicht sits perched above Kloof Street, adjacent to Vredehoek with only Buitenkant Street separating the two. Homes here are large and gracious with enviable views of Table Mountain, the foreshore and the distant Hottentots Holland Mountains. Apartments here are popular with students from the Cape Technikon, and close to Gardens Centre, making shopping only a quick walk away and transport negligible.
